Protocol
- anti-VCA EBV IgG and IgG avidity is a solid-phase immunoanalytical test. A specific antigen representing immunodominant epitopes of the VCA complex is bound to the surface of the wells. If antibodies are present in the test samples, they will bind to the immobilized proteins. The bound antibodies then react in the next step with horseradish peroxidase-labeled anti-human IgG antibodies. The amount of bound labeled antibodies is determined by a color enzymatic reaction. Negative samples do not react, a slight change in the color of the wells is the background of the reaction. To determine avidity, each sample is applied in parallel to two wells, with the appropriate antibodies binding to the immobilized antigens. In the next step, one well is incubated with the wash solution, the other well with the urea solution. In the first well, specific antibodies with high and low avidity remain bound to the antigen. In the second well, low-avidity antibodies are released due to the concentrated urea solution, and only high-avidity antibodies remain complex with the antigen. The ratio between the optical density of the well with the urea solution and the well with the washing solution in percent expresses the relative avidity index (RAI).
